Why is Data Science Pertinent?

Data is today’s most precious resource, regardless of whether it is perishable. Leading companies, such as Google, Amazon, and Meta, use data to enhance customer experiences, boost profitability, and achieve strategic goals. Data that is dispersed widely in both structured and unstructured formats is the problem. Businesses will always need data science and people in order to collect data, organize and analyze it, gain valuable insights from it, and present it for informed business decisions.

We can say that Data Science is the secret to turning information into useful knowledge, which uses vast amounts of data to predict actions and derives meaning from meaningfully linked facts. Data science involves the practice of gathering, purifying, processing, analyzing, and communicating the findings to relevant parties.

Data science enables us to get incredible insights into how objects function and how people act. It can offer unexpected insights on a wide range of topics, including personality traits and speech habits, for instance. In this way, Data science is assisting companies to optimize innovation by helping them find the best customers, charge the right pricing, accurately allocate expenses, minimize work-in-progress and inventory, and more.

How much does a Data Scientist earn in Sydney?

In today’s competitive job market, only professionals with the most recent and up-to-date skills are likely to be chosen from the hiring manager’s pool of applicants. This proves the fact that a data science career is promising. The same applies to the big fat paycheck data science professionals in Sydney get!

  • The average yearly salary for a data scientist in Sydney is AUD 111,500, as per glassdoor.com.
  • According to Indeed.com, a data scientist’s salary in Sydney is AUD 132,224 per annum and AUD 9,368 per month. This amount is 10% above the national average salary.

What makes AI Pertinent?

With the aid of artificial intelligence, machines or computer programs may complete tasks in a “smart” manner. With the help of AI, a computer or machine may respond to situations in real life by using its own thinking, judgment, and intention.

A system’s capacity to mimic the abilities of human intelligence is known as artificial intelligence from the standpoint of a beginning. It occurs when systems are trained to simulate machines engaging in cognitive processes like learning and decision-making. 

AI is used in Google search algorithms, recommendation systems, self-driving cars, and even autonomous weapons. So yes, AI is a popular trend in the business world. For the last five years, AI has been trending upward, and its peak is still predicted to be reached by 2030. AI has become an essential component of many sectors due to its capacity to eliminate human participation and simplify difficult processes while increasing corporate productivity.

How much does an  AI Engineer earn in Sydney?

Since the field of artificial intelligence is expanding reasonably quickly, there is a significant demand for experts who are knowledgeable in it. In the current job market, the AI profession is relatively secure. There are slim odds of an impending job shortfall in the AI economy. According to your field of competence, the income ranges can be rather high.

The Bureau of Labor Statistics estimates that by 2030, the number of positions for data scientists and mathematical scientists, who are essential to AI, would increase by 31.4%. This indicates a very bright future for the subject of artificial intelligence.

According to Salaryexpert.com, the average AI Engineer Salary in Sydney is 160,800 AUD a year.

  • An entry-level AI engineer in Sydney with 1 to 3 years of work experience would likely receive a yearly salary of AUD 112,887.
  • A senior-level AI engineer with 8+ years of experience would receive a salary of AUD 200,051 a year.

A machine learning engineer in Sydney would receive an average salary of AUD 139,627 per year which would be 13% above the national average salary for any job. (Indeed.com) 

Conforming to the World Economic Forum, “AI and Machine Learning Specialists” are the second most coveted job roles in the world.
